What should I do immediately after a bus accident?
Seek medical attention first, then document the scene with photos and gather witness information. Report the accident to authorities and preserve any evidence.

Who can be held responsible for a transit accident?
Liability may fall on drivers, transit companies, maintenance providers, government entities, or other motorists depending on circumstances.

How long do I have to file a transit accident claim?
Deadlines vary but are often shorter for government entities. Consult an attorney promptly to avoid missing filing windows.

What compensation can I seek after a transit injury?
Compensation may include medical expenses, lost wages, rehabilitation costs, and damages for pain and suffering.

Do I need a lawyer for a minor transit injury?
Even minor injuries can have complications. Legal advice helps understand your rights and potential compensation.

How are transit accident claims different from car accidents?
Transit claims often involve government entities, multiple insurers, and specific regulations governing public transportation.

What if I was partially at fault for the accident?
Virginia follows contributory negligence rules, but an attorney can evaluate how this affects your specific situation.

How long does a transit accident case typically take?
Timelines vary from months to years depending on case challenge, injury severity, and whether settlement or trial occurs.

What evidence is important for transit accident cases?
Important evidence includes accident reports, maintenance records, surveillance footage, witness statements, and medical documentation.

Can I sue a government transit agency?
Yes, but specific procedures and shorter deadlines apply. Legal help ensures proper claim filing.

What if the bus driver claims immunity?
Drivers may have certain protections, but exceptions exist. An attorney can analyze applicable laws and potential liability.

How are settlement amounts determined?
Settlements consider medical costs, lost income, injury severity, liability clarity, and impact on daily life activities.
